Major Responsibilities:

Along with attending to the requisite duties of a solo pastor in a 190-member congregation, she/he will need to foster congregational revitalization and growth. Over time, several factors contributed to waning attendance at worship, shrinking membership rolls, a failure to attract younger families with children, and a steady increase in the average age of the congregation. FPC remains active, vital, and committed to openness, Presbyterian practice and mission, but some changes will be needed.

The possibilities include (1) a more effective evangelism program, (2) initiatives for youth and college students (3) greater emphasis on spiritual development, (4) new mission projects, and (5) a blended worship service that combines the familiar Presbyterian style with contemporary forms of expression. There will be challenges for sure, but so too will there be opportunities for successful new ministries. Warrensburg is a growing community sustained by the presence of a mid-sized university and a nearby Air Force base. It retains the ambiance of a small town, but its close proximity to Kansas City provides easy access to the attractions of a major metropolitan center. The University of Central Missouri is a thriving institution that has been, and likely will continue to be, important in the life of FPC. Whatever course it chooses to follow, FPC will need skillful, imaginative, and caring pastoral guidance.
